Title: Amends Certain Environmental Laws Regarding Mining and Water Pollution

Vote Smart's Synopsis:

Vote to pass a bill that amends previous environmental laws regarding mining and water pollution.

Highlights:

 

  • Specifies that this section does not apply to ferrous and nonferrous mining operations with regard to the placement, removal, use, or processing of mineral tailings or mineral deposits being placed in inland waters on bottomlands owned by or under the control of the ferrous or nonferrous mineral operator unless there is to be a discharge of waste or waste effluent from the inland waters into waters of the state (Sec. 3116).

  • Specifies that this part does not apply to the discharge of water from underground ferrous and nonferrous mining operation unless there is to be a discharge of waste or waste effluent into the waters of the State (Sec. 3116).

  • Specifies that the exemptions do not apply to inland waters owned by or under control of a ferrous or nonferrous mineral operator if there is an inland lake or stream that flows both into those inland waters and out from those inland waters directly into the waters of the state (Sec. 3116).
